Abstract

Water resource carrying capacity and ecology deficit in the Shule river basin were studied using ecological footprints. The capacity gradually increased from 1 696. 35 ha to 1 925. 26 ha, the total ecological footprint from 19 714. 23 ha to 32 236. 35 ha, and ecological deficit from 18 017. 88 ha to 30 311. 08 ha from 2003 to 2007. The water resource ecological carrying capacity is presently overloaded in the Shule river basin. Because of increasing population growth and farmland expansion, there are more pressures on the regional water resources. In the future, measures such as taking an appropriate immigration policy, increasing public awareness of water conservation education, adjusting the industrial structure, and controlling the planting area should be carried out.
